Following an extensive transformation programme, the 2M2C will officially welcome visitors back from 3 July 2026 with the 60th edition of the Montreux Jazz Festival. The reopening represents the start of a new operational phase for the venue. From 1 August 2026 onwards, the centre will host a programme of congresses, corporate events, exhibitions and cultural gatherings. A new website, featuring updated content and a redesigned digital platform, is scheduled to launch in September 2026.
Diverse Event Programme Scheduled Through 2027
The confirmed event calendar includes a range of scientific congresses, association meetings, corporate events and cultural performances. Among the first events are the Annual Congress of the Swiss Society for Microbiology in August 2026 and the Joint Annual Meeting of SSI and SSHH in September. The programme also includes concerts, festivals and public events such as the Montreux Comedy Festival, the Swiss Pain Congress and the 2M2C Open Day. Additional events are already scheduled into 2027, reflecting the venue’s role as a location for both business and cultural activities in the region.
